WebFeb 24, 2015 · The diagram below shows the heat flow through two different pathways: the framing of a wall (#1) and an insulated cavity (#2). The heat that goes through the insulated cavity (#2) has a harder go of it because insulation is more resistive to heat flow than wood is. The short red arrows indicate that less heat flows through that path. External Wall Insulation. External wall insulation is the best way to insulate your. walls. External insulation involves fixing insulation materials such as mineral wool or expanded polystyrene slabs to the outer surface of the wall.
